Description

Software installed on the clusters is organised and managed with environment modules that allow choosing a specific version of a software package compiled with a given compiler, linked to chosen libraries, etc. This session explains how modules are used on the clusters.

Contents:

  • The installed software
  • The modules command
  • What is Easybuild
  • What are the different toolchains
  • how to install software by yourself

Prerequisite:

  • Being able to use SSH with private keys 
  • Being familiar with a text editor 
  • Mastering the Linux command line and the GNU utilities (mkdir, cp, scp, etc.)
